SOOO glad I made the stop at Tapped. I was looking for dog friendly early dinner spots on Camano after checking out the local recommended parks good for dogs, and saw Tapped had dog- friendly space.

Counter ordering as you come in, quick, helpful and patient while I tried to keep my dog behaved and figure out what to eat. I landed on the prime rib dip – the absolute BEST I’ve ever had. The pretzel bun texture alone is to die for, slightly crisp outside with a light and soft inside. The au jus loaded with onions (love!), and choice of fries, tots, or side salad.

They have so many unique options on tap, but for us non-tap drinkers they have decent options for white abd red wine and champs.

Bundled outside, I had the most attentive service as a party of one plus my furry compadre. So kind, personable, genuine connection between 4 different staff members! Aside from the ridiculous prime rib dip I’ll be dreaming of, the kindness of the staff is unmatched.

This is our 4th takeout from Tapped Camano in the last 2 months. My husband likes their fish n’ chips, so I have been trying to find something I like on the menu. The first two times, I ordered tacos off their starter menu. They’re not bad, but the value isn’t there. The last order I tried one of their burgers, and it was okay, but the meat was dry and crumbling, and the bacon jam was different from than I have ever tried. Yesterday, I tried a pretzel burger. The meat was super dry again; however, to be fair, I did order it without the cheese sauce. The bacon and the bun were completely black. I cut the burger in half to eat it, and the meat just crumbled. Are the burgers worth $18? Not even close. Is a taco worth $8? Nope. All four times we’ve gotten pick up, they’ve had different levels of busy. They have taken ample time on all four occasions. I will continue to try again for the sake of my husband’s fish n’ chips, but if you are looking for a place that provides quality food with reasonable prices, unfortunately, this is not the place. You will have a long wait, but the staff is friendly.

Food tried in total:
Fish n chips- good
Tacos- all meat options- okay, but not great
Sweet potato and regular fries are awesome!
Pretzel Burger burnt and inedible
Crab mac n cheese super dry
Prime rib sandwich okay in flavor
